Description

n-(4-Aminophenyl)Tetrahydro-2H-Pyran-4-Carboxamide is a high-purity chemical intermediate featuring a unique molecular scaffold combining an aromatic amine with a tetrahydropyran moiety. This compound is valued for its role as a versatile building block in advanced organic synthesis, enabling the development of novel pharmacologically active molecules. It is primarily sought by research institutions and pharmaceutical companies engaged in the discovery and development of new therapeutic agents and fine chemicals.

Basic Information

Product Name n-(4-Aminophenyl)Tetrahydro-2H-Pyran-4-Carboxamide
CAS No. 1219949-47-9
Molecular Formula C12H16N2O2
Molecular Weight 220.27 g/mol

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ent moisture uptake and oxidation.
